This review is from: A Thousand Roads [Original Soundtrack] (Audio CD)
Thanks for the background on this movie's soundtrack Mr. Davids, and it's great to know you support Native American musicians. But to give this album one star out of five just because Lisa Gerrard isn't Native American is ridiculous, and frankly, racist. Peter Gabriel's "Long Walk Home: Music from the Rabbit-Proof Fence" was a similarly haunting, ethereal collection of songs. The movie focused on the aboriginal peoples of Australia. Think anyone cared that Peter Gabriel isn't an aborigine? Like Gabriel, Gerrard has worked with musicians of several ethnic origins, and has always made efforts to support and promote them. This in turn increases cultural awareness of marginalized ethnicities for the mainstream consciousness, and represents one of the fundamental altruistic forces in what has been blanket-termed "world music." We should applaud musicians like Gerrard, not castigate them. Or, the very least, we should judge music by the talent of the composer, not by that composer's ethnicity. -Amahl Turczyn Scheppach, music lover. Ethnic Origin: White/Other.

This review is from: A Thousand Roads [Original Soundtrack] (Audio CD)
If Dead Can Dance were composing these days, they should - probably - sound like on this CD!
This is a road that leads you to the heart of the North American Indians. In my opinion Lisa's voice fits in the mood this theme very well - as fit so good in Whale Rider - It's a tremendous voice wich is capable of the most stimulating and sublime enchantment - There is no need of words, only the Voice. This amazing CD although invoking the North American Indians it's a contemporary piece of music blend with textures and atmosphere - Sometimes it's an artifice but works very well because it leads you there. I like it a lot and Lisa's voice continues the same - haunting and beautiful as ever. It brings to my mind great Lisa Gerrard songs such as 'Sacrifice', 'Abwoon' and Dead Can Dance's 'The Host of Seraphim'. If you like Lisa Gerrad, Dead Can Dance and a great music score, you'll probably like this one. I'm in love with it...
